**Vendor note: Inkmill markdown pipeline**

Rendering for Parchway docs is outsourced to Inkmill under an annual contract, renewing each March. They handle sanitization and PDF export; we own the upload queue. SLA: 4-hour response on rendering failures. Escalate only after two failed retries. Their support desk is reachable at the address below.

billing contact of hahaf-baguf = zorael.tammir.jorius@sivrelhq.internal

Runbook: digest scheduling. The Bramblewire batch emailer kicks off digests at 06:00 local per region — if a region's queue is empty, it skips silently, which is normal. If digests are late, check the scheduler lease first; it's usually a stuck lock. Restart the lease-holder and note the trace below.

build token for kagaf-hahof: htk14_9d3d4d26d7d8de

MEMO — Kettling Depot Receiving

Uniform sets for the new Kettling depot arrive Wednesday via Ashgrove courier: 40 boxes, sorted by size, manifest attached to box one. Check the count at the dock before signing; shortages go straight to stores, not the courier. The hand-over instruction the courier will follow is set out below.

drop instructions, tafof-baguf: the holmir gilox courier leaves the sormir ulaok holdor ledger at gate 5596 under passcode 257343

- [ ] Key ceremony step 7 — Flagwright rollout framework

Before support can toggle emergency kill-switches in Flagwright, the ceremony must re-seal the flag-override keyring and verify two custodians witnessed it. Confirm the staging toggle flips within 30 seconds, then lock the console. If support later needs override access outside a ceremony, the console will prompt for the recovery passphrase noted below.

strongbox words: wenix-ulador

CI note: flaky ordering in Lanthorn report builder

The comparison tests for Lanthorn's report builder intermittently fail on the Brindlevale runners. Root cause: the grouping step used an unstable sort, so rows with equal totals swapped order between runs. Fixed by switching to a stable sort and adding a secondary key on row id. Do not "fix" flakes by loosening the snapshot diff — that masked this for weeks. If it recurs, check for new unkeyed aggregations first. Reproduced and verified on the build below.

trace token, kahog-tajeg: htk6_97d963